.bodybg {
    background-image: url('bg.jpg');
    background-size: cover; /* Stellt sicher, dass das Bild den gesamten Bereich abdeckt */
}

body, html {
    height: 100%;
    margin: 0;
    display: flex;
    justify-content: center;
    align-items: center;
     /*background-color: #f7f7f7; /* Hintergrundfarbe */
}


.container {
    display: flex;
    flex-direction: column;
    align-items: center;
    gap: 20px; /* Abstand zwischen den Elementen */
    /*border: 2px solid black; /* Schwarzer Rand für den äußeren Container */
    padding: 20px; /* Abstand im Inneren des Containers */
    background-color: white; /* Hintergrundfarbe für den Container */
}

.content {
    display: flex; /* Flexbox-Layout für die Elemente nebeneinander */
    gap: 20px; /* Abstand zwischen den Elementen */
}

.textarea_index, .output_index {
    width: 390px;
    height: 250px;
    border: 2px solid black; /* Schwarzer Rand */
    justify-content: center;
    /* Weitere Stilisierung nach Bedarf */
}






